Vegetable Oil-based Epoxide Monomers:Synthesis And Copolymerization With Anhydride And CO2

Biomass-based polymers have been received much attention due to the advantages in the environmental protection and resource conservation.In this study,several vegetable oil-based polycarbonates were synthesized by the copolymeration of cyclic anhydride and/or CO2with vegetable oil-based epoxide which were prepared from10-undecenoic acid(a biobased fatty acid derived from castor oil).The resulting biobased polycarbonates with C=C double bonds could be post-polymerization modified by mercaptan with long alkyl chain through thiol-ene click reaction and the comb-like polymer with variable phase transition temperature have been achieved.This provides a feasible approach for the high value-added utilization of vegetable oil.The main conclusions are as follows:1.Two vegetable oil based epoxide monomer,oxiran-2-ylmethyl 10-undecenoate(OYU)and epoxide methyl 10-undecenoate(EMU),were synthesized from 10-undecenoic acid cracked by castor oil.It was found that the yield was increased by 23%by recrystallization instead of vacuum distillation method in the preparation of OYU.2.The copolymers of EMU/CO2 and OYU/CO2(POYUC)were synthesized under the catalysis of zinc glutarate(Zn GA)and double metal cyanide(DMC),respectively.The effects of reaction temperature,time and the amount of DMC catalyst on POYUC were studied.The results displayed that terminal OYU monomer with high reactivity,which could achieve 100%conversion(m(OYU):m(DMC)=10000:1,110?,t=1 h).In addition,P-1 polymer dissolved in petroleum ether and P-2 polymer precipitated in petroleum ether were obtained respectively by using DMC to catalyze OYU,PO and CO2.1H NMR and GPC curves indicated that the content of carbonate and the molecular weight(Mn)of P-2 were higher than P-1.With the feed ratio of PO/OYU increasing,the mass fraction of P-2 increased from 26.7% to 95.5%.3.Comb-like POYUC-g-R polymers with different side chain lengths were synthesized by grafting mercapto functional monomers to the alkyl side chains of POYUC polymers through a thiol-ene click reaction.It was found that the decrease of molecular weight of POYUC caused by the UV light-mediated the breaking of ether linkage in the polymer chain in the grafting reaction.The melting temperature(Tm)and enthalpy(?Hm)of POYUC-g-R respectively increased from-15.0 ? and 34.1 J/g to 69.3 ? and 108.5 J/g with the increase of alkyl side chain length from 10 to 28.Moreover,the alkyl side chains were arranged in the form of hexagonal(?H)crystals indicated by XRD.
